How useful are radiomics and machine learning (ML) in clinical practice when it comes to stroke prediction? In our recent systematic review and meta-analysis, alongside a narrative review led by Roberta Scicolone, we explored the use of radiomics and machine learning to differentiate symptomatic and asymptomatic carotid artery plaques. In the systematic review we analyzed the methodological quality of research from 2005 to 2023, revealing promising results for radiomics-based ML models in identifying culprit plaques using CT and MRI. Notably, combining radiomics with clinical data achieved the highest predictive performance (AUC 0.89), underscoring the potential of radiomics and ML in early cerebrovascular event prediction. #Radiomics #MachineLearning #Stroke Feel free to read the full studies for more details: https://lnkd.in/dAhVgSim; https://lnkd.in/dQzJDcT2
